Samaritan House III offers private room accommodations at a monthly cost of $4,110. This pricing reflects the facility's commitment to providing quality care and support within its community. Comparatively, this rate is slightly above the average for Prince George's County, where private room costs are approximately $3,792. However, it aligns closely with the overall state average in Maryland, which stands at around $4,112. This positioning indicates that while Samaritan House III is competitively priced within the broader market, it also emphasizes its unique offerings and amenities that contribute to the higher cost.
Room Type | Samaritan House III | Prince George's County | Maryland |
---|---|---|---|
Private | $4,110 | $3,792 | $4,112 |
Samaritan House III in Oxon Hill, MD is a wonderful assisted living community offering a range of amenities and care services to ensure a comfortable and fulfilling lifestyle for its residents. The community features a spacious dining room where delicious meals are served, providing nutritious options for individuals with special dietary restrictions. Each living space is fully furnished and residents can enjoy the beautiful outdoor garden area.
Housekeeping services are provided to maintain a clean and organized environment. Move-in coordination assistance is offered to make the transition into Samaritan House III as smooth as possible. Residents can stay connected with loved ones through telephone and Wi-Fi/high-speed internet access.
Care services at Samaritan House III include assistance with activities of daily living such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. The staff also coordinates with health care providers to ensure comprehensive care for each resident. Diabetes diet management and medication management are available to cater to specific medical needs. Special dietary restrictions are accommodated, ensuring that everyone's nutritional requirements are met.
Transportation arrangements for medical appointments are made for the convenience of residents. Additionally, there are various nearby amenities that enrich the experience at Samaritan House III. There are 5 cafes, 1 park, 10 pharmacies, 2 physicians, 19 restaurants, 6 transportation options, 1 theater, and 3 hospitals in close proximity.
Residents can also participate in scheduled daily activities designed to promote socialization and engagement within the community.
